解释器
python第一行注释_浅谈Python脚本开头及导包注释自动添加方法
python第⼀⾏注释_浅谈Python脚本开头及导包注释⾃动添加⽅法1、开头:#!/usr/bin/python和# -*- coding: utf-8 -*-的作⽤ – 指定#!/usr/bin/python是⽤来说明脚本语⾔是python的是要⽤/usr/bin下⾯的程序(⼯具)python,这个解释器,来解释python脚本,来运⾏python脚本的。#!/usr/bin/python:是...
解析pip安装第三方库但PyCharm中却无法识别的问题及PyCharm安装第三方...
解析pip安装第三⽅库但PyCharm中却⽆法识别的问题及PyCharm安装第三⽅库的⽅法教程⽬录python默认安装路径⼀、问题具体描述:⼆、解决⽅法1、⽅法⼀:在PyCharm下载第三⽅库(即把之前下的库作废,这⾥重新再下⼀次……)2、⽅法⼆:坚持⽤pip的⽅法安装第三⽅库三、扩展延伸——pip install 安装路径问题这个是遵守“就近原则”的!即:python安装⽬录解释器就⽤该⽬录下的...
python解释器在哪里_详解查看Python解释器路径的两种方式
python解释器在哪⾥_详解查看Python解释器路径的两种⽅式进⼊python的安装⽬录, 查看python解释器进⼊bin⽬录# ls python(看⼀下是否有python解释器版本)# pwd (查看当前⽬录)复制当前⽬录即可1. 通过脚本查看运⾏以下脚本,或者进⼊交互模式⼿动输⼊即可。import sysimport osprint('当前 Python 解释器路径:')print(s...
php运行机制
PHP的运行机制可以分为以下几个步骤:读取PHP脚本:当Web服务器(如Apache)接收到一个HTTP请求时,会将请求发送给PHP解释器。PHP解释器读取并解析PHP脚本。编译PHP脚本:PHP解释器将PHP脚本转换成字节码(又称中间码),这是一种类似于汇编语言的二进制代码,可以被PHP虚拟机(Zend Engine)所执行。php如何运行代码执行PHP脚本:PHP虚拟机将字节码转换成可执行的机...
脚本执行命令实例详解
脚本执⾏命令实例详解使⽤linux不免要⽤到执⾏脚本,⽐如⼀个⽂件a.sh,我们有时会见到⽤. a.sh 去执⾏,有时见到⽤sh a.sh 去执⾏,或者bash a.sh ,或者source a.sh ,那么这两种执⾏脚本的⽅式有什么区别呢?这个问题也困惑了本⼈很久,今天总结⼀下:⾸先考虑这样⼦⼀种情况: 我的作⽤⽂件有时候路径⽐较长,为什么不创建⼀个脚本放在初始路径下,这样运⾏⼀下直接到到位,于...
Linux终端执行shell脚本
linux循环执行命令脚本Linux终端执⾏shell脚本1. 直接执⾏ sh script-name或者bash script-name当脚本本⾝没有执⾏权限或者脚本开头没有指定解释器时所⽤。2. 将shell脚本改为有执⾏权限的,再在⽬录⾥⾯执⾏chmod +x script-name./script-name补充在脚本开头⼀般要指定解释器,⽽解释器路径可以通过 which bash查看脚本打...
powershell正则表达式 提取
powershell正则表达式 提取摘要:1.PowerShell 简介 2.正则表达式的概念和基本语法 3.在 PowerShell 中使用正则表达式的方法 4.提取字符串的例子正文:regex匹配1.PowerShell 简介 PowerShell 是一个由微软开发的命令行解释器和脚本语言,它可以在 Windows 操作系统上运行。PowerSh...
jerryscript 交叉编译
jerryscript 交叉编译(最新版)1.交叉编译的概念与意义 2.JerryScript 的特点与应用场景 3.JerryScript 的交叉编译流程 4.交叉编译的优点与局限性 5.总结正文1.交叉编译的概念与意义交叉编译,又称为交叉平台编译,是指在一个平台上编译得到另一个平台上可执行的代码。这种编译方式广泛应用于嵌入式系统、游戏开发以及软件...
C#和lua相互调用的方法教程
C#和lua相互调⽤的⽅法教程前⾔⾃从ulua在官⽹上出来后,lua 就被u3d开发⼈员喜爱。国内有⼏个⾼⼿把lua拿过来 接着进⾏了封装。很多都是新⼿转过来。lua语法⼀看遍知,但是⼤多数⼈还是不明⽩两个语⾔之间的互相调⽤是怎么⼀回事,这也是难点和重点。所以今天想跟⼤家分享⼀下这⽅⾯的知识,让⼤家少⾛弯路吧。Lua是⼀种很好的扩展性语⾔,Lua解释器被设计成⼀个很容易嵌⼊到宿主程序的库。LuaI...
c#执行python方法
c#执⾏python⽅法在C#使⽤Python脚本⽂件要注意的的是,⾸先要将IronPython2.7安装路径中的两个dll⽂件添加到C#引⽤中⼀个是IronPython.dll,另⼀个是Microsoft.Scripting.dll库⽂件;其次在代码中添加引⽤如下所⽰:using IronPython.Hosting;//引⽤ironpython⽂件using Microsoft.Scripti...
运行python程序的两种方式交互式和文件式_执行Python程序的两种方式
运⾏python程序的两种⽅式交互式和⽂件式_执⾏Python程序的两种⽅式交互式(了解)交互式环境下,敲完⼀条命令按下enter键马上能看到结果,调试程序⽅便。程序⽆法永久保存,关掉cmd窗⼝数据就消失了。命令⾏式(了解)打开⽂本编辑器,在⽂本编辑器中写⼊⼀串字符。⽂本编辑器写的代码毫⽆意义,只是⼀堆字符,并且⽂件的后缀名没有影响。由于python语⾔是解释型语⾔,我们直接使⽤python打开⽂...
Python-import导入上级目录文件
Python-import导⼊上级⽬录⽂件假设有如下⽬录结构:-- dir0 | file1.py | file2.py | dir3 | file3.py | dir4 | file4.pydir0⽂件夹下有file1.py、file2.py两个⽂件和dir3、dir4两个⼦⽂件夹,dir3中有file3.py⽂件,di...
python中import sys用法
python中import sys用法(实用版)1.导入 sys 模块 2.sys 模块的功能 3.sys.argv 和 sys.argv[0] 4.sys.stdin 和 sys.stdout it() 函数 dules 和 sys.path 7.sys.version正文在 Python 编...
python3.8学习心得(4)异常处理
python3.8学习⼼得(4)异常处理⼀、常见的内置异常BaseException:所有异常的基类。System Exit:Python解释器请求退出。KeyboardInterrupt:⽤户中断执⾏。Exception:常规错误的基类。StopIteration:迭代器没有更多的值。GeneratorExit:⽣成器(generator)发⽣异常通知退出。StandardError:所有内置标...
python的try和except用法_tryexcept(多个except)多异常处理
python的try和except⽤法_tryexcept(多个except)多异常处理在python中,try except是基本的捕获并处理异常的语句,try except语句⾥try代码块写⼀个即可,except 代码块可以写多个,每个except 块都可以参与处理1个或者多个异常。我们先从理论上知道下try except 语句的执⾏流程:1、⾸先执⾏try⼦句(在关键字try和关键字exc...
MobaXterm下,在ubuntu系统中,运行指定位置的py程序
MobaXterm下,在ubuntu系统中,运⾏指定位置的py程序利⽤MobaXterm这个远程管理服务软件,在Ubuntu16.04.5下安装了Python3.6,在此总结⼀下Ubuntu下.py⽂件的⼏种运⾏⽅式(此处以test.py为例):1. 程序编写a、⼀个python解释器如果⾃⼰只有⼀个python编辑器(python3.6),⼀般在py⽂件的第⼀⾏会写上#!/usr/bin/env...
ubuntu下安装httprunner,从python2升级到Python3,解释器错误:权限不...
ubuntu下安装httprunner,从python2升级到Python3,解释器错误:权限不够Ubuntu中提⽰python 2.7即将失效升级到python3后,安装hrunner pip3 install httprunner安装完成后,执⾏hrun -V查看,显⽰的是bash: /usr/local/bin/har2case:/usr/bin/python:解释器错误: 权限不够ubun...
c#和python哪个好_理性分析Python和C#哪个更有前途?
学python看谁的视频比较好c#和python哪个好_理性分析Python和C#哪个更有前途?Python与c#的技术差异很⼤,但都适合web开发,以下是Python与C#详细对⽐分析:Python原本就被设计的类似⽤英语表达⼀样,只要你使⽤合适的变量名称,许多表达式就很容易读懂。另外,由于Python语法简单,没有像句法括号和⼤量的修饰词,各种类C的构造和不同的初始化变量,所以Python写的...
如何在Linux系统中编写、编译和运行Tcl程
Tcl Hello World Example: How To Write,Compile and Execute Tcl Programon Linux OS系统中编写、、编译和运行Tcl程序程序??实例::如何在Linux系统中编写Tcl Hello World 实例原文出处:点击这里by Ramesh Natarajan on April 9, 2010 ShareThis由Ramesh N...
java解释器模式举例
java解释器模式举例解释器模式(Interpreter Pattern)是一种行为型设计模式,它用于定义一个语言的语法解释器,并解释语言中的句子。解释器模式通常用于处理特定领域的语言或规则,例如编程语言、正则表达式等。以下是一个简单的Java解释器模式的示例,用于解释简单的数学表达式。首先,定义一个抽象表达式接口 `Expression`,它包含一个解释方法 `interpret`:```jav...
java编译原理
Java编译原理: Java 虚拟机(JVM)是可运行Java 代码的假想计算机。只要根据JVM规格描述将解释器移植到特定的计算机上,就能保证经过编译的任何Java代码能够在该系统上运行。本文首先简要介绍从Java文件的编译到最终执行的过程,随后对JVM规格描述作一说明。 一.Java源文件的编译、下载 、解释和执行 Java应用程序的开发周期包括编译、下载 、解释和执...
java执行python代码_在java中调用执行python代码(一)
java执⾏python代码_在java中调⽤执⾏python代码(⼀)极少数时候,我们会碰到类似这样的问题:与A同学合作写代码, A同学只会写Python,不熟悉Java ,⽽你只会写Java不擅长Python,并且发现难以⽤Java来重写对⽅的代码,这时,就不得不想⽅设法“调⽤对⽅的代码”。下⾯,我就通过⼀些简单的⼩例⼦来说明:如何在Java中调⽤Python代码。什么是Jython?Jyth...
C,Java和Python三门编程语言性能比较
C,Java和Python三门编程语⾔性能⽐较在编程中有许多语⾔,⽽不同的编程语⾔有时候也能实现相同的功能,那么不同语⾔之间的运⾏速度有多少差别呢?这⾥选择 , 和三门热门语⾔来做⽐较。实验这⾥使⽤三种语⾔进⾏矩阵乘法。矩阵的⼤⼩为2048 x 2048(即每个矩阵的乘法和加法运算为8,589,934,592),我为它们填充了0.0到1.0之间的随机值(使⽤随机值⽽不是对所...
Python的另外几种语言实现
Python的另外⼏种语⾔实现python转java代码Python⾃⾝作为⼀门编程语⾔,它有多种实现。这⾥的实现指的是符合Python语⾔规范的Python解释程序以及标准库等。这些实现虽然实现的是同⼀种语⾔,但是彼此之间,特别是与CPython之间还是有些差别的。下⾯分别列出⼏个主要的实现。1.CPython:这是Python的官⽅版本,使⽤C语⾔实现,使⽤最为⼴泛,新的语⾔特性⼀般也最先出现...
java代码调用python_如何在Java中调用Python代码
java代码调⽤python_如何在Java中调⽤Python代码有时候,我们会碰到这样的问题:与A同学合作写代码,A同学只会写Python,⽽不会Java,⽽你只会写Java并不擅长Python,并且发现难以⽤Java来重写对⽅的代码,这时,就不得不想⽅设法“调⽤对⽅的代码”。下⾯我将举⼀些简单的⼩例⼦,借此说明:如何在Java中调⽤Python代码。看懂这篇⽂章只需要具备:熟悉Java的基本语...
java程序设计语言的优势及特点
java程序设计语⾔的优势及特点java语⾔是⼀种⾯向对象的程序设计语⾔吗java语⾔是⾯向对象的程序设计语⾔⽀持部分或绝⼤部分⾯向对象特性(类和实例、封装性、继承、多态)的语⾔即可称为基于对象的或⾯向对象的语⾔。Java 跟C#是⽬前最流⾏的两门⾯向对象语⾔。⾯向对象语⾔可以归类为:1、基于对象的程序设计语⾔;2、⾯向对象的程序设计语⾔。⾯向对象编程具有以下优点:1、易维护采⽤⾯向对象思想设计的...
转:脱机环境下window使用pycharm连接cx_oracle连接数据库
转:脱机环境下window使⽤pycharm连接cx_oracle连接数据库#sample 1 Python 2,7 已经安装,可以正常跑,但是cx_oracle windows 版本下载下来,⽆法安装1.现在现在版本 cx_Oracle-5.3-11g.win-amd64-py2.7(321.4 kB) 是5.3 版本,配套oracle 11g client ,配置windos 64 位的2,安...
mysql全文检索关联查询_MySQL--全文检索(自然语言全文检索)
mysql全⽂检索关联查询_MySQL--全⽂检索(⾃然语⾔全⽂检索)⾃然语⾔全⽂本检索缺省或者modifier被设置为in natural language mode,都是进⾏⾃然语⾔检索。对于表中的每⼀⾏,match()都会返回⼀个关联值。mysql> CREATE TABLE articles (-> id INT UNSIGNED AUTO_INCREMENT NOT NULL...
python库的说明文档_Python34中文手册(官方文档)
python库的说明⽂档_Python34中⽂⼿册(官⽅⽂档).pdf Python34中⽂⼿册(官⽅⽂档)Python tutorial 3.4 documentation » next | indexNext topic Python ⼊门指南1. 开胃菜Release: 3.4This Page Date: March 29, 2014Show SourcePython 是⼀门简单易学且功能...
python3模块大全_Python3模块菜鸟教程
python3模块⼤全_Python3模块菜鸟教程Python3 模块在前⾯的⼏个章节中我们脚本上是⽤ python 解释器来编程,如果你从 Python 解释器退出再进⼊,那么你定义的所有的⽅法和变量就都消失了。为此 Python 提供了⼀个办法,把这些定义存放在⽂件中,为⼀些脚本或者交互式的解释器实例使⽤,这个⽂件被称为模块。模块是⼀个包含所有你定义的函数和变量的⽂件,其后缀名是.py。模块可...